Output 30e66c9f90f441d647963c0f949f7eb073bc873c662f4e74e4242c901b30a608:0

value
308843
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dbeb6506dcef043c93cdc7d258bf268a681f9a2 OP_EQUALVERIFY OP_CHECKSIG
address
16dUgcgRMMfodxwH3E7CWG8zVUc4RfxMUz
transaction
30e66c9f90f441d647963c0f949f7eb073bc873c662f4e74e4242c901b30a608
confirmations
375075
spent
true